Ticket: Exports that fail on Murkwell's nightly batch just die silently — no retry, no alert. New folks: the exporter lives in the `dispatch-out` service, and the retry queue exists but was never wired up. Fix is to enqueue on 5xx with backoff. To repro, trigger a failure and grab the trace shown below.

trace token, fafog-kageg: htk4_98e6

Alert: Brightkit component library version skew detected. A consuming app is pinned to a major version two behind current, which usually means breaking changes snuck past the deprecation window. Future maintainers: don't just bump the pin and hope — check the migration notes first, since theming tokens moved in v4. The compatibility matrix and upgrade steps live on the page below.

operations page: https://jira.qorvelsys.internal/browse/pages/browse/pages

Finance Review Summary — Customer Concentration, Verelux Group

Revenue concentration remains elevated: the Dunmoor account represents 31% of recurring income, up from 26% last year. Two further accounts together add 18%. Contract renewal timing clusters in the second quarter, compounding exposure. Heads of department should factor this into hiring and inventory commitments. Mitigation options are under review, and the confidential note below sets out the plan.

internal memo for faweg-hahip: Silokix Works plans to lower the Tamvan list price by 8 percent in June.

Handover note — Crumbwheel order cutoffs.

Welcome aboard. The bakery cutoff rule in Crumbwheel closes same-day orders at 14:00 local to each storefront, not UTC — this has bitten us twice. Holiday overrides live in the calendar service and take precedence silently, so always check there first when a cutoff looks wrong. To unlock the calendar service's admin console after a restart, enter the recovery passphrase below.

vault phrase of bagap-bahaf = silion-pelox-sorox-casdor-quenwyn-fraax-eliox-praael-kelion-quenvan-kasox-rusael-norius-belvan